HoverBot Go Crazy!

Afternoon!


 Ok, so after going out for supplies I have built my prototype Hovercraft, and its fun to play with! As Scott noted, there are so many experimental possibilities with this project, the number of CD's, the amount that you inflate each balloon, the angles between the CD's, there are endless possibilities! However, for the basic Craft, the best solution is just to have 2 Cd's Joined by 2 straw supports, (though personally I prefer 3) and then the balloons on top for the power. Therefore, this is the basic model I will include in my worksheet, however I will add a list of suggestions of experiments that can be done, which would be great for  design class or a bored teenager on holiday!

Hey Guys,
 Well I have been experimenting with the hovercraft idea, and have made a few discoveries!

  1. The CD is easier to control if it has a 'skirt' around it, as this creates a smaller airflow area
  2. The shorter the skirt, the faster it will move
  3. If you add straws at the side of the side of the 'skirt' it slows the craft down, and makes it easier to control.

Basically, a balloon has replaced the fan and motor, as the air is released it pushes the CD upwards enough to allow movement, which is what I like, however , it is uncontrollable. BUT! I have a plan! I would like to attach four of these together on a frame, and then inflating the balloons different amounts should allow different patterns of movement! I want to use straws for the frame to keep it as light as possible, and then add a skirt to improve the air flow, and maybe some straws depending on how well it works!
